岛式水文(位)站往往采用高桩式水工建筑物,为避免船舶横向外力的破坏,需在水文(位)站前沿两侧设置保护桩。目前,上海地区大都采用钢筋砼保护桩,它具有承载力适中、防腐蚀、耐久和经济等优点,但不足之处是弹性和抗冲击能力较差,容易被撞裂、剥落,甚至撞断,使用寿命缩短,一般只有20~30年。因此,在迁建米市渡水文站工程时,我们首次采用了墩台式钢管保护桩,经使用表明,效果
